Are You Mad, Raya? Arsenal Keeper Proves He’s World-Class Again

“David Raya are you mad?” that was the cry from Arsenal fans after yet another world-class performance from the Spaniard, this time against Olympiacos. Raya once again reminded the footballing world that he’s not just a good goalkeeper, but perhaps the very best in the game right now.

“David Raya showed his class again tonight. Absolutely world class goalkeeper. He’s been the best keeper in the world this season by some distance,” one fan declared, and it’s hard to argue.

His breathtaking stop against Olympiacos wasn’t only about the acrobatic dive, it was the anticipation, the balance, and the quick decision-making that separated him from the rest.

Such moments are becoming routine for Raya. Often criticized in the past for supposedly not being an elite shot-stopper, the Arsenal No. 1 has been rewriting that narrative week after week. “He’s the best keeper in the PL. Has it all. People say he’s not a great shot stopper. But he probably has the best highlight reel of great saves in the last 3 seasons alone.” From reflex saves to commanding his box, Raya continues to deliver at the highest level.

This season in particular, his consistency has been jaw-dropping. “This year itself has been pretty crazy saves. Dominates the box aerially, never drops the ball when he goes for it. Punches the ball decisively and have had near assists from his distribution from his own goal.”

In addition, his distribution has become a vital weapon for Mikel Arteta’s Arsenal, with Raya launching precision passes that spark counter-attacks.

The numbers back it up too. According to Squawka Football, “David Raya has the best save percentage of any goalkeeper in the Premier League so far this season (86.67%).” That’s not just good it’s elite.
